UPVC Door Repair: A Comprehensive Guide
UPVC (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ride) doors have ended up being a popular choice for property owners due to their toughness, energy effectiveness, and low maintenance needs. Nevertheless, like all parts of a home, they are not immune to use and tear with time. This short article provides a useful introduction of UPVC door repair, covering typical issues, repair techniques, and maintenance tips to lengthen the life of these essential home fixtures.
Common Issues with UPVC Doors
UPVC doors, while robust, can encounter various problems that may need repair. Here are some of the most regular concerns:
Issue | Description |
---|---|
Misalignment | Doors do not close appropriately, typically due to settling or wear. |
Locking Mechanism Failure | Problem in locking/unlocking due to rust or malfunction. |
Drafts and Leaks | Air leakages around the edges, recommending worn seals or frames. |
Harmed Hinges | Broken or rusty hinges affecting door functionality. |
Scratches and Scuffs | Aesthetic damage that might need refinishing or replacing. |
Misalignment
One of the most typical problems with UPVC doors is misalignment. This can result from the door settling in time or inappropriate installation. Signs include trouble opening or closing the door, spaces at the edges, and increased wear on the locking mechanism.
Locking Mechanism Failure
The locking system on UPVC doors is essential for security. If the lock fails, it can be due to dirt, rust, or internal malfunction. Common indications include the key getting stuck or turning but not engaging the lock.
Drafts and Leaks
Drafts can significantly decrease a home's energy performance. A worn or broken rubber seal around the door can allow cold air in, defeating the function of insulation.
Harmed Hinges
Hinges can end up being rusty or harmed, triggering the Door Panel Experts to sag or stick. Regular maintenance can help avoid this problem.
Scratches and Scuffs
Visual damage might not affect the door's performance however can affect curb appeal. Scratches and scuffs need attention to keep visual appeal.
Repair Methods for UPVC Doors
Correcting these concerns may need professional aid or can often be handled as DIY tasks. Here are some reliable techniques for UPVC door repair:
1. Changing Misalignment
- Tools Needed: Screwdriver, Allen wrench
- Steps:
- Loosen the screws on the hinge and change the door's position.
- Examine the positioning with a level.
- Tighten the screws as soon as properly aligned.
2. Repairing the Locking Mechanism
- Tools Needed: Lubricant, screwdriver
- Steps:
- Apply silicone spray or graphite powder to the lock.
- If the lock is still malfunctioning, think about changing it with a suitable model.
3. Changing Worn Seals
- Tools Needed: Utility knife, replacement seals
- Steps:
- Remove the old seal by cutting it away.
- Clean the surface before applying the new seal.
- Press the brand-new seal into place and trim excess length.
4. Repairing Hinges
- Tools Needed: Lubricant, rust remover, replacement hinges if needed
- Actions:
- Clean the hinges with rust eliminator.
- Apply lube to keep them running efficiently.
- Replace hinges that are too damaged to work.
5. Attending To Scratches and Scuffs
- Tools Needed: UPVC cleaner, polish, touch-up paint
- Steps:
- Clean the scratched area.
- Usage touch-up paint that matches the door color for deeper scratches.
- Apply polish to bring back shine.
Maintenance Tips for UPVC Doors
To avoid the requirement for repair work and extend the life of UPVC doors, routine maintenance is vital. Here are simple maintenance suggestions:
- Regular Cleaning: Clean the door with a mild cleaning agent and a soft cloth to prevent dirt buildup.
- Oil Hardware: Regularly lubricate locks and hinges to guarantee smooth operation.
- Look for Drafts: Periodically examine the seals for wear and replace them when essential.
- Check Locks: Ensure that locks are functioning and check for rust or dirt buildup.
- Tighten up Screws: Regularly inspect screws on hinges and locks to guarantee they are tight.
FAQs About UPVC Door Repair
Q: How do I understand if my UPVC door requires repairs?
A: Look for signs such as trouble closing, drafts, harmed seals, or use on the locking system.
Q: Can I repair a scratched UPVC door myself?
A: Yes, small scratches can be fixed utilizing touch-up paint and polish.
Q: Is it worth repairing a malfunctioning lock?
A: Yes, Door Panel Customization fixing or changing a malfunctioning lock is important for home security.
Q: How frequently should I carry out maintenance on my UPVC door?
A: A bi-annual inspection and maintenance routine is recommended to catch potential concerns early.
